saccharin and Cocaine-Related Disorders

saccharin has been researched along with Cocaine-Related Disorders in 24 studies

Saccharin: Flavoring agent and non-nutritive sweetener.
saccharin : A 1,2-benzisothiazole having a keto-group at the 3-position and two oxo substituents at the 1-position. It is used as an artificial sweetening agent.

Cocaine-Related Disorders: Disorders related or resulting from use of cocaine.
